The classic rock revivalists, The Darkness, are scheduled to return to Brighton as part of their extensive 'Bands of Brothers Arena Tour'. This isn't just a standard gig; it’s being billed as their largest headline tour in twenty years, marking a significant return after what has been described as a period in the 'wilderness'. If you’re planning your calendar for late 2026, the date to circle is Tuesday, December 15th. The show is confirmed for the Brighton Centre, located right on Kings Road (BN1 2GR).

The Darkness isn't coming alone; they are bringing a strong lineup to the coast. The tour features both Brothers Osborne and the band A as special guests, suggesting a full evening of music. If you’re planning your arrival, the doors are scheduled to open relatively early, at 18:00 (6:00 PM). The Brighton Centre typically offers both seating and standing options for these large-scale events, so you can choose the format that suits you best for this major stop on the tour.
For those who already secured their spot, the general sale for tickets began back on Friday, November 28, 2025, at 10:00 a.m., following a pre-sale that started two days earlier. If you are organizing a group, it’s worth noting that there was a limit set at a maximum of six tickets per person during the initial sales period. Also, if you plan on bringing younger fans, the venue specifies that anyone under the age of 14 must be accompanied by an adult.
